What companies run services between Cyberjaya, Malaysia and Taman Desa,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ia?

Rapid KL operates a subway from Putrajaya Sentral to Kuchai every 10 minutes. Tickets cost RM 2–4 and the journey takes 25 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from (M) Ppj254 Mrt Putrajaya Sentral to Kl1283 Shell via Sj516 Lotus Extra Puchong in around 53 min.
